Iraqi Oil Exports Will Be Delayed Until New Humanitarian SuppliesPlan Is Ready And Approved
In a surprise move that caught oil markets and UN diplomats off-guard,Iraq has decided to delay its oil exports until it receives approval for a newhumanitarian supplies plan for the second 180- day phase of the oil-for-food scheme.
